## Sensor Drift in GrowHaven Controllers

New team members should know that the humidity and temperature probes in GrowHaven greenhouse controllers drift measurably after roughly ninety days of continuous operation. The Calibra service corrects this automatically, but only if its signed calibration baseline is intact. If the baseline file is corrupted or missing, the controller falls back to raw readings, which can over-water entire bays. To restore the sealed baseline from the Fenmoor archive, enter the recovery passphrase provided below.

recovery phrase for bawef-haduf: wenax-druox-julmir

## Currency Rounding in Session Totals

Session carts in Ledgerpine convert prices at checkout, not at add-to-cart. Rounding happens per line item, then totals are summed — so totals can differ from converting the sum directly. This is expected; do not "fix" it mid-incident. If totals drift more than one minor unit, flush the affected session via the admin API, authenticating with the token below.

session JWT of yawep-yawep = eyJhbGciOiJIUzI1NiIsInR5cCI6IkpXVCJ9.eyJzdWIiOiI3pWF3_In0.aXYsHiog

FAQ: What if the Renderloft transcoding farm stalls?

Q: Jobs queued but no workers picking up?
A: Usually the scheduler lost its lease. Restart the dispatcher on the Bramble cluster; don't touch worker nodes directly. Stuck encodes older than 2h can be requeued safely. If the scheduler's state vault is sealed after restart, unseal it with the recovery passphrase listed immediately below.

vault phrase of bagaf-kajeg = jorath-feniel-briir-siliel-ralix

TURN-208: Gatevale turnstile counters at the Merrow Field pilot double-count when a rotation reverses mid-cycle. Attendance totals drift roughly 2% high per event. The debounce window fix is implemented, reviewed by Ilsa, and soak-tested across two simulated match days without drift. Ready for your cut; the candidate build is identified below.

trace token, tagag-tafog: htk6_5ed18c